Transaction 7d76a59f8df3f48c25c4ab2b3430439c3f6c48f337bc5705fe6b705393314112

1 Input
1 Outputs
  • 7d76a59f8df3f48c25c4ab2b3430439c3f6c48f337bc5705fe6b705393314112:0
  • value  14312891
    address  1QA3gkf1UkXHQkmG2zWuFnELFDovhv3U3u